in 9–14, use the data to write a ratio for each comparison in three different ways. a person’s blood type is denoted with the letters a, b, and o, and the symbols + and −. the blood type a+ is read as a positive. the blood type b− is read as b negative. 9. o+ donors to a+ donors 10. ab− donors to ab+ donors 11. b+ donors to total donors 12. o− donors to a− donors 13. a+ and b+ donors to ab+ donors 14. a− and b− donors to ab− donors 15. which comparison does the ratio \\(\frac{90}{9}\\) represent? 16. which comparison does the ratio 20:21 represent? blood donors table: type a+ has 45 donors, b+ has 20, ab+ has 6, o+ has 90, a− has 21, b− has 0, ab− has 4, o− has 9, total has 195

Explanation:

Response
Problem 9: O+ donors to A+ donors

Step1: Identify the number of O+ and A+ donors.

From the table, O+ donors = 90, A+ donors = 45.

Step2: Write the ratio as a fraction.

The fraction form is $\frac{\text{O+ donors}}{\text{A+ donors}} = \frac{90}{45}$.

Step3: Write the ratio using a colon.

The colon form is $90 : 45$.

Step4: Write the ratio in word form.

The word form is "90 to 45".

Problem 10: AB− donors to AB+ donors

Step1: Identify the number of AB− and AB+ donors.

From the table, AB− donors = 4, AB+ donors = 6.

Step2: Write the ratio as a fraction.

The fraction form is $\frac{\text{AB− donors}}{\text{AB+ donors}} = \frac{4}{6}$.

Step3: Write the ratio using a colon.

The colon form is $4 : 6$.

Step4: Write the ratio in word form.

The word form is "4 to 6".

Problem 11: B+ donors to total donors

Step1: Identify the number of B+ donors and total donors.

From the table, B+ donors = 20, total donors = 195.

Step2: Write the ratio as a fraction.

The fraction form is $\frac{\text{B+ donors}}{\text{total donors}} = \frac{20}{195}$.

Step3: Write the ratio using a colon.

The colon form is $20 : 195$.

Step4: Write the ratio in word form.

The word form is "20 to 195".
